The best way to cook beaver??

Posted By: ShaneW

The best way to cook beaver?? - 01/01/12 02:54 AM

I cut the backstraps out of a recently trapped beaver. My wife soaked them in salt water with some vinegar for 48 hours. Then she cooked them in a skillet with some seasonings. Honestly, it tasted a lot like venison to me. Very gamey tasting and a bit tough. Any suggestions for next time....if I can get her to cook it a next time. We both were a bit let down. Please advise on some beaver cooking tips.
